Ingredients
– 200 grams all-purpose flour
– 200 grams granulated sugar
– 4 large eggs
– 100 ml whole milk
– 150 grams unsalted butter, softened
– 10 grams baking powder
– 5 ml vanilla extract
– 250 grams fresh strawberries, sliced
– 300 ml heavy cream
– 50 grams powdered sugar
– Pinch of salt

Ingredient Swaps and Additions
Feel free to get creative! Swap out strawberries for other berries like raspberries or blueberries for a mixed berry extravaganza. For a unique flavor profile, add a hint of lemon zest or some chopped mint to the whipped cream. If you’re looking to make it a bit richer, use mascarpone cheese in place of half of the heavy cream. The options are endless!
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Preheat your oven to 175°C (347°F) and prepare your cake pan by greasing and flouring it.
2. In a m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ter and granulated sugar** until the mixture is light and fluffy, as this is the secret to an airy cake!
3. Add the eggs one at a time, making sure to beat well after each addition. A splash of vanilla extract makes this blend even more heavenly!
4. In another bowl, combine the flour, baking powder, and salt, sifting them together for even distribution. Alternate adding this mix with the milk to the wet ingredients; start and end with the flour mixture. Mix until just combined—overmixing is a no-no!
5. Pour the batter into the prepared pan, using a spatula to level the top. Bake for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Your kitchen will begin to smell divine!
6. Once baked, let the cake cool in the pan for about 10 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ely.
7. While the cake cools, whip together heavy cream and powdered sugar with an electric mixer until you achieve stiff peaks—this is where the magic happens!
8. Once cooled, carefully slice the cake into two horizontal layers.
9. Spread whipped cream on the bottom layer, layer on those beautiful sliced strawberries, and then place the top layer. Cover the entire cake with the remaining whipped cream.
10. Finish off with more fresh strawberries on the top, creating a stunning final touch. Chill before serving, and it’s ready to wow your guests!

Pro Tips for Success
– Make sure all your ingredients are at room temperature for better emulsification.
– Use fresh strawberries that are just ripe for the best flavor.
– Don’t skip the cooling time; a properly cooled cake will hold its layers beautifully.
Storing and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. While it’s best enjoyed fresh, you can gently rewhip leftover cream if needed. For the best taste, consume within two days after making!
FAQ Section
– Can I use frozen strawberries? While fresh strawberries are best for this recipe, you can use frozen ones if necessary; just be sure to thaw and drain them well to avoid excess moisture.
– What if I want to make this as a cupcake? You can easily adapt this cake recipe into cupcakes. Just adjust the baking time to around 18-20 minutes.
